Exploration and Practice of Employment Competence of Management Graduate Students from the Perspective of Iceberg Model of Competencies

Abstract:

Objective To study the current situation of employment competence of management graduate students, and to put forward some suggestions to optimize the training method. Methods Based on the iceberg model of competencies, Python crawler technology was used to collect information on enterprises’ employment demands for graduate students from the campus recruitment data of Zhilian Campus. Questionnaires were designed to collect extensive data, and SPSS and AMOS were used for analysis. After screening and multiple rounds of expert evaluation, a competence model for management graduate students was constructed. Results and Conclusion The study found that the current competence level of management graduate students was generally consistent with the demand of enterprises, but there was still a certain gap. To better meet the needs of enterprises, educators need to strengthen the comprehensive capabilities of management postgraduate students across disciplinary knowledge, research competence, talent demonstration and adaptability, management skills, and personality traits. At the same time, targeted training and educational guidance should be carried out to comprehensively improve the overall quality of graduate students.
